J&K completes drone survey in 4,497 villages; over 81,000 property cards prepared under SVAMITVA | KNO

Ladakh records 100% coverage; property cards issued in 225 villages

Srinagar, Jul 21 (KNO): The Central government on Tuesday informed Parliament that drone-based land surveys have been completed in all 4,497 notified villages of Jammu and Kashmir under the SVAMITVA Scheme, with 81,305 property cards prepared across 2,130 villages to facilitate rural property ownership and improve land record management. In a written reply to an unstarred question in the Lok Sabha, the Ministry of Panchayati Raj, as reported by the news agency—Kashmir News Observer (KNO), said that nationwide drone surveys have been completed in over 3.30 lakh villages, while 3.24 crore property cards have been prepared for nearly 1.97 lakh villages under the SVAMITVA Scheme. The Ministry said that in Jammu and Kashmir, the highest number of property cards has been prepared in Jammu district (27,021), followed by Kathua (13,246), Pulwama (7,655), Samba (7,214) and Doda (6,498). Srinagar recorded 1,951 property cards, while Ganderbal accounted for 902. No property cards have so far been prepared in Anantnag, Bandipora and Baramulla districts. For Ladakh, the Ministry said drone surveys have been completed in all 232 notified villages. Property cards have been prepared for 225 villages, with 18,788 property cards issued, including 9,831 in Leh and 8,957 in Kargil. The Ministry, however, said no assessment has been undertaken to measure the reduction in property-related disputes, the time taken for land record verification and registration, or improvements in land administration following implementation of the scheme. It added that an impact evaluation conducted by IIM Ahmedabad found an increase in bank loans availed against property cards and higher revenue from Gram Panchayat property taxes and other local taxes after implementation of the SVAMITVA Scheme—(KNO)
